Trading above the consensus fair value
Bajaj Housing Finance Ltd closed at ₹84.22, 48.7% above the consensus fair value of ₹56.65 drawn from 8 valuation models.
Financial DNA score 48/100 — Average. P/E of 25.9x against the 20x sector multiple the P/E model uses.

Graham Number
₹44.48
-47.2%
√(22.5 × EPS × BVPS)
EPS=3.07, BVPS=28.65 · outside Graham range (P/E 25.9, P/B 2.9) — asset-light, treat as a rough floor
